MegaDev AI Workshop
The MegaDev AI Workshop runs from October 26 to November 1 and aims to deepen participants' understanding of generative AI. The schedule covers topics such as the mechanics of generative AI, steering models through context, building knowledge systems, working with AI harnesses, and constructing workflows. The workshop is led by Theo Browne, who emphasizes practical applications and strategic integration of AI tools.
